B.S. Kitchen

Indian·$$

This cozy Indian and Nepali spot is a favorite, particularly celebrated for its incredibly flavorful naan, especially the cheese variant. The friendly, welcoming staff create a genuinely warm atmosphere, making it a go-to for both solo diners and small groups seeking a delicious and affordable meal.

Yorozuya

Japanese·$$

This is a warm, family-run okonomiyaki and monjayaki spot where the owners' genuine hospitality shines. They excel at making foreigners feel welcome, offering a taste of local downtown Tokyo culture with dishes cooked right at your table.

Kyushu-Ya Kamaboko Shop
80DineGuides
Score

Kyushu-Ya Kamaboko Shop

Japanese·$$

This long-standing oden shop in the Oku Ginza shopping district offers a taste of childhood for many locals. It's a place where you can choose your own ingredients from large simmering pots, a rare sight these days. Beyond the comforting oden, they also offer a variety of homemade fish paste dishes and tempura.

Moranbong
77DineGuides
Score

Moranbong

Korean·$$

Moranbong is a long-standing yakiniku spot that locals have frequented for years, offering a taste of traditional Korean BBQ with a focus on fresh, flavorful meats and authentic side dishes. While the casual, sometimes smoky atmosphere might feel a bit dated, the quality of the food, particularly the signature dishes like kobukuro sashimi and beef tongue, makes it a worthwhile stop for enthusiasts.
